Petra Knaup is a scholar working on Health Information Management, Molecular Biology and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, Petra Knaup has authored 118 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 48 papers in Health Information Management, 39 papers in Molecular Biology and 20 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in Petra Knaup's work include Electronic Health Records Systems (47 papers), Biomedical Text Mining and Ontologies (38 papers) and Scientific Computing and Data Management (14 papers). Petra Knaup is often cited by papers focused on Electronic Health Records Systems (47 papers), Biomedical Text Mining and Ontologies (38 papers) and Scientific Computing and Data Management (14 papers). Petra Knaup coll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Netherlands and United States. Petra Knaup's co-authors include Reinhold Haux, Elske Ammenwerth, Sebastian Garde, Christian Kohl, Matthias Ganzinger, Werner Herzog, Alexander Hoerbst, Evelyn Hovenga, Daniel Capurro and José E. Pérez‐Lu and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Journal of Medical Internet Research.
